Branson from Branson Preface Today Branson, Missouri is a very popular place with a lot of entertainment options.   My neighbor up here in Central Idaho took a train across Canada and then down to Branson on one of many potential travel options.   He really enjoyed his stay in Branson but noted that the trip could have been more interesting if I wrote a book about some of the original Branson’s, particularly a namesake. The town is named after one of my grandfather’s brothers.   There were nine boys in all, my grandfather being Jefferson Davis Branson (he went by Dave).   I am being told the history by my father who got most of it from stories told around the campfire in the early 1900’s.   My father, Joseph David Branson was born in 1890 and I was born in October of 1942 so he was 52 when I was born.   He was almost 60 when he first started telling me the stories.   I was born six days too late to enter elementary school in Boise, Idaho so I had to sit out another year.
